![]() If you do not already know, then, despite the fact that there is a mountain above you, and it would seem, you could also build something, the second floor, the third one - no, nothing to build It is impossible to go up. The difference of the first floor is only that the vault door is two-room (with that strange, it accommodates two people, not four), and the elevator (1) will begin immediately after him. Strategically, there is no sense in building a room if you do not want to grow it to the maximum (in this place). "Three-room premise" in the previous paragraph is a three-room premise. ![]() It makes sense in this configuration and build. The width of the pit under the shelter is ideal for building each floor (except the first one) in the configuration of a three-room apartment (A) - an elevator (1) - three rooms (B) - an elevator (2) - a two-room (C).
